A Comparison of Maternal Age, Gestational Age, and Maternal Weight between Groups The maternal age of the GH, PE, and SPE groups was higher than that of the control group; however, this did not reach statistical significance ( P = 0.299).The gestational age of the GH, PE, and SPE groups was smaller than that of the control group, although there were no significant differences ( P = 0.283).
